Barbershop owner shoots, kills armed robber in self-defense, authorities say

  

SAN ANTONIO – The owner of a barbershop shot a man multiple times during an attempted robbery, according to San Antonio police.

The shooting happened around 7:30 p.m. Wednesday in the 2000 block of Basse Road.

Police said the man entered the barbershop while it was open and started demanding wallets and purses while flashing a gun.

One of the business owners, described as a man, did not comply quickly enough with the orders and was pistol-whipped by the other man, according to SAPD.

The suspect then focused his attention on the other business owner, a woman, and pulled out zip ties. At the same time, the male business owner pulled out a gun and shot the man multiple times in the chest, SAPD told KSAT.

The man who attempted to rob the business was hospitalized with life-threatening injuries.

Police said the male business owner had the right to use lethal force and is not expected to face charges.
